Ifølge en nylig undersøkelse utført av Digital Inclusion Norway, opplever hele 61% av nettbrukerne utfordringer med tastaturnavigasjon på norske nettsider. Dette er en kritisk faktor for å overholde EAA-kravene og unngå potensielle bøter.
Innledning: Hvorfor Tasterstavennavigasjon Er Mer Viktig Enn Noensinne
Tasterstavennavigasjon, eller keyboard navigation, er prosessen med å navigere gjennom en nettside ved hjelp av tastaturet alene, uten å bruke musen. Dette kan virke som en liten detalj, men det er en fundamental del av digital tilgjengelighet. Mange brukere er avhengige av tastaturnavigasjon – personer med motoriske utfordringer, skjermlesere, eller de som bare foretrekker det.
EAA (European Accessibility Act), som trådte i kraft i 2025, setter strenge krav til digital tilgjengelighet for offentlige og private tjenester. Mange bedrifter og organisasjoner i Norge må nå sørge for at sine nettsider og applikasjoner er fullt tilgjengelige via tastatur. Manglende overholdelse kan føre til betydelige EAA-bøter.
Hvem Er Avhengige Av Tasterstavennavigasjon?
Det er viktig å forstå hvem som benytter seg av tastaturnavigasjon. Listen er langt mer omfattende enn mange tror:
- Personer med motoriske utfordringer: De som har vanskeligheter med å bruke musen på grunn av cerebral parese, MS, eller andre fysiske begrensninger.
- Brukere av skjermlesere: Skjermlesere, som NVDA, JAWS og VoiceOver, er avhengige av logisk og forutsigbar tastaturnavigasjon for å tolke innholdet på skjermen.
- Personer med kognitive utfordringer: Tastaturnavigasjon kan gi en mer strukturert og forutsigbar opplevelse for de som har vanskeligheter med å fokusere eller bearbeide visuell informasjon.
- Brukere med midlertidige utfordringer: En brukere med brukket arm, en ødelagt mus eller en situasjon der man ikke kan bruke mus, er også avhengig av tastaturnavigasjon.
- Profesjonelle brukere: Webutviklere, testere og innholdsredaktører bruker ofte tastaturnavigasjon for å effektivt undersøke og vedlikeholde nettsider.
EAA-Kravene og Tasterstavennavigasjon: Hva Må Du Oppfylle?
EAA-regelverket er komplekst, men kjernen i kravene knyttet til tastaturnavigasjon er klar: alle funksjoner og innhold må være tilgjengelige og opererbare ved hjelp av tastaturet. Dette innebærer mer enn bare å kunne navigere mellom lenker; det krever en logisk og forutsigbar rekkefølge, tydelige fokustilstander og muligheten til å utføre alle handlinger som kan utføres med en mus.
Spesifikke krav inkluderer:
- Logisk rekkefølge: Fokus skal bevege seg gjennom elementer i en forutsigbar og logisk rekkefølge.
- Tydelige fokustilstander: Det skal være klart for brukeren hvilket element som har fokus, visuelt eller auditivt.
- Mulighet til å utføre alle handlinger: Alle handlinger som kan utføres med en mus, må også kunne utføres med tastaturet. Dette inkluderer å klikke på knapper, fylle ut skjemaer og navigere gjennom menyer.
- Unngå "keyboard traps": Brukere skal ikke bli fanget i et element der de ikke kan forlate ved hjelp av tastaturet.
- Tilgang til dynamisk innhold: Innhold som endres dynamisk (f.eks. ved hjelp av AJAX eller JavaScript) må også være tilgjengelig via tastaturnavigasjon.
Vanlige Feil Ved Tastaturnavigasjon – Og Hvordan Unngå Dem
Selv tilsynelatende små feil i tastaturnavigasjon kan skape store problemer for brukere. Her er noen vanlige fallgruver og hvordan du kan unngå dem:
- Ulogisk fokusrekkefølge: Fokus hopper rundt på skjermen i en tilfeldig rekkefølge, noe som gjør det vanskelig å finne veien. Løsning: Bruk HTML-struktur og
tabindex-attributtet (med forsiktighet) for å definere en logisk rekkefølge. - Manglende visuell indikasjon av fokus: Det er vanskelig å se hvilket element som har fokus. Løsning: Sørg for en tydelig visuell markering av fokuserte elementer, f.eks. ved hjelp av en ramme, endret farge eller skygge.
- "Keyboard traps": Brukeren blir fanget i et element og kan ikke forlate ved hjelp av tastaturet. Løsning: Sørg for at alle elementer kan forlater ved hjelp av
Tab-tasten eller en "Escape"-mekanisme. - Skjulte elementer: Elementer som er skjult visuelt, men tilgjengelige via tastaturet, kan forvirre brukeren. Løsning: Unngå skjulte elementer eller sørg for at de er tydelig indikert for tastaturbrukere.
- Upassende bruk av
tabindex: Overdreven bruk avtabindexkan forstyrre den naturlige fokusrekkefølgen. Løsning: Bruktabindexbare når det er absolutt nødvendig, og vær nøye med å opprettholde en logisk rekkefølge.
Case Study: Hvordan En Nettbutikk Forbedret Tilgjengeligheten
En norsk nettbutikk som solgte sportsutstyr, opplevde et fall i konverteringsraten og mottok klager på tilgjengelighet. Etter en grundig tilgjengelighetsvurdering ble det avdekket flere problemer med tastaturnavigasjonen. Fokuseringen var ulogisk, og det var vanskelig å finne frem i produktkatalogen.
Bedriften implementerte endringer, inkludert en revidert HTML-struktur, tydeligere fokustilstander og en forbedret rekkefølge for fokus. Resultatet var en betydelig forbedring i brukeropplevelsen for tastaturbrukere, samt en økning i konverteringsraten og redusert antall klager. De reduserte også risikoen for EAA-fines betydelig.
Utfordringer Med Å Implementere God Tastaturnavigasjon
Selv om prinsippene for god tastaturnavigasjon er relativt enkle, kan implementeringen være utfordrende:
- Kompleks JavaScript: Dynamiske nettsider som bruker mye JavaScript kan være vanskelige å gjøre tilgjengelige via tastaturet.
- Tilpasninger: Tilpassede brukergrensesnitt krever ofte ekstra arbeid for å sikre at tastaturnavigasjonen fungerer som den skal.
- Testing: Det er viktig å teste tastaturnavigasjonen grundig med ulike skjermlesere og tastaturoppsett.
AI-Drevet Tilgjengelighet: En Ny Vinkling
Manuell testing og feilretting av tastaturnavigasjon er tidkrevende og ressurskrevende. Accessio.ai tilbyr en AI-drevet løsning som automatiserer mye av denne prosessen. Den skanner kildekoden og identifiserer automatisk problemer med tastaturnavigasjon, og foreslår løsninger. Dette er en mye mer effektiv tilnærming enn tradisjonelle metoder, spesielt for store og komplekse nettsider. I motsetning til overleggsløsninger (overlays), fikser Accessio.ai problemer på kildekode-nivå, noe som sikrer en mer robust og pålitelig løsning.
Key Takeaways
- Tasterstavennavigasjon er en kritisk del av digital tilgjengelighet og påvirker en betydelig andel av nettbrukerne (61%).
- EAA-regelverket stiller strenge krav til tastaturnavigasjon, og manglende overholdelse kan føre til EAA-bøter.
- Vanlige feil inkluderer ulogisk fokusrekkefølge, manglende visuell indikasjon av fokus og "keyboard traps."
- AI-drevne tilgjengelighetsverktøy som Accessio.ai kan automatisere mye av arbeidet med å sikre god tastaturnavigasjon.
- Å prioritere tastaturnavigasjon er ikke bare et juridisk krav, men også et etisk ansvar for å skape en inkluderende digital opplevelse.
Next Steps
- Utfør en tilgjengelighetsvurdering: Evaluer dine nettsider og applikasjoner for å identifisere problemer med tastaturnavigasjon.
- Prioriter feilretting: Fokuser på de mest kritiske problemene som hindrer brukere i å navigere og bruke nettsiden din.
- Implementer løsninger: Gjør de nødvendige endringene i HTML-strukturen, CSS-stiler og JavaScript-kode.
- Test grundig: Test tastaturnavigasjonen med ulike skjermlesere og tastaturoppsett.
- Vurder AI-drevet tilgjengelighet: Utforsk løsninger som Accessio.ai for å automatisere prosessen og sikre en robust og pålitelig løsning.
- Hold deg oppdatert på EAA-kravene: Følg med på endringer og oppdateringer i EAA-regelverket.
Vi oppfordrer alle bedrifter og organisasjoner i Norge til å ta tak i disse utfordringene og skape en mer inkluderende digital verden.